We need Junction View Photo contribution for Major Expressway and Highway exit. U also can contribute other Jucntion u think needs JCV.

Download latest JCV location at post 2

A simple guidelines:

1. Take the photo in a clear sky morning, better to be Saturday or Sunday where there is less traffic.

2. It is better to have a photographer and a driver in your car. Don't risk your life.

3. Set your camera setting to highest mega pixels photo.(better use 10megapixel and above camera)

4. Set your camera setting to Infinity/Landscape/Sport mode.

5. Drive on the lane next to the exit lane when approaching Junction.

6. Take one photo showing clearly the major Signboard.

7. Take another photo nearer to the junction.

8. The picture u takes should be not too dark or too many car inside the picture.

9. Save the junction location with your gps unit/data logger. You might need to use mapsource to adjust your waypoint a bit to the exact junction location.

10. 1 junction view save in 1 folder include the coordinates.gdb. Example can see the link below
